No Payment Accepted - Alcohol and Drug Rehab Facilities - Columbus, GA.

There are some drug and alcohol rehab centers that help individuals through their struggles with alcohol or drug abuse without paying. As an example, there are state funded alcohol and drug rehab centers that are publicly funded or perhaps paid for via both state or federal funds. Some of these facilities work out of mentalhealth centers funded by the state or paid for via local municipalities, and substance abuse rehab programs and clinics. Many of these facilities have particular conditions that people in Columbus need to meet to qualify for rehab, and clients of lower income and with limited or no health coverage are the most typical individuals at treatment centers where no payment is accepted. To get care at a treatment center where no payment is accepted, you may need to show your residency in the state and possibly your legal residency in the U.S., provide information regarding income or lack thereof, and be available for an assessment of your drug history, physical health and mental health.

If a person if seeking a substance abuse rehab center where no payment is accepted, a good place to begin looking is with their local or state substance abuse and mental health departments. An additional assistance source is local church groups and similar faith-based groups who run programs which include services for alcohol and drug addiction and dependency. A number of these groups even provide beds for individuals while they are in rehab and until they get back on their feet.
